Waste management is a key challenge faced by many countries worldwide. With the increase in waste production, it is important to find innovative and sustainable ways to manage it. This is where the waste paper cardboard recycling production line comes in.
The waste paper cardboard recycling production line is a state-of-the-art technology designed to transform waste paper and cardboard into new and useful products. The process involves shredding the waste paper and cardboard into small pieces, which are then mixed with water and chemicals to create a pulp. The pulp is then dried and pressed into new paper and cardboard products.
This technology has numerous benefits for the environment. Firstly, it reduces the amount of waste in landfills, which helps to mitigate the negative impact of waste on the environment. Secondly, it reduces the need for virgin materials, such as wood pulp, which helps to conserve natural resources. Finally, it reduces greenhouse gas emissions, as the production of recycled paper and cardboard requires less energy than the production of virgin materials.
In addition to the environmental benefits, the waste paper cardboard recycling production line also has economic benefits. It creates new jobs in the recycling industry, which helps to boost economic growth. It also reduces the cost of waste management, as recycling is often cheaper than landfilling.
Despite these benefits, there are some common questions about the waste paper cardboard recycling production line. Here are some answers:
Q: What types of paper and cardboard can be recycled using this technology?
A: This technology can recycle most types of paper and cardboard, including newspaper, magazines, cardboard boxes, and office paper.
Q: Is the recycled paper and cardboard of the same quality as virgin materials?
A: Yes, the quality of recycled paper and cardboard is comparable to that of virgin materials. In fact, some recycled paper products are of higher quality than their virgin counterparts.
Q: Is the waste paper cardboard recycling production line expensive to operate?
A: While the initial investment in the technology can be high, the operational costs are often lower than those of traditional waste management methods. Additionally, the economic benefits of the technology often outweigh the costs.
In conclusion, the waste paper cardboard recycling production line is an innovative and sustainable solution to the challenge of waste management. It has numerous environmental and economic benefits and is a crucial step towards a more sustainable future.
